Cage Code

3B Echelon Pl

East Tamaki

AUCKLAND, New Zealand

Phone : +64 508 552 700

Unit 5, 343 Church St

Onehunga

AUCKLAND, New Zealand

Phone : +64 9 633 0040

125 Harvard Ln Ardmore Airfield

AUCKLAND, New Zealand

Phone : +64 9 299 7133

1 Lincoln Ave

Tawa

WELLINGTON, New Zealand

Phone : +64 4 232 3233

Unit 2, 125 Naenae Rd

Lower Hutt

WELLINGTON, New Zealand

Phone : +64 4 566 5345

1 Ivan Jamieson Pl

CHRISTCHURCH, New Zealand

Phone : +64 3 357 1761

Level 2, Cnr Moorhouse Ave & Madras St

Christchurch

NSW, New Zealand

Phone : +64 3 379 8310

38 Water St

Whangarei

NORTHLAND, New Zealand

Phone : +64 9 470 1910

35 Bryant Rd

Te Rapa

Hamilton

WAIKATO, New Zealand

Phone : +64 7 850 5300

70 Stanley St

Auckland City

AUCKLAND, New Zealand

Phone : +64 9 379 0360